Under Old Business the agenda lists a Community Development Supplemental Grant intended to complete current residential sewer projects and a separate stormwater retention project with several possible tank sites. The stormwater item names potential locations: Bohlken Park, West 227th, Alexander Road, Nelson Russ Park, and 22100 Mastick Road; the transcript does not record site selection, budget figures, or a formal vote.

Both items are recorded as updates for the committee to track; the agenda excerpt does not include staff reports, cost estimates, or timelines in the transcript lines provided.
